Description David Ripton 2004-09-13 10:59:19 UTC
dev-java/jdepend-2.8-r1 needs jdepend-2.8.zip

files/digest-jdepend-2.8-r1 says:
MD5 b714e71096d6206b75aa2bc612894e3f jdepend-2.8.zip 386130

This matches what's currently on the primary source, http://www.clarkware.com/software/jdepend-2.8.zip

However, there was a previous different version of jdepend-2.8.zip from the jdepend-2.8 ebuild.  So if you already had jdepend-2.8 installed, the file will probably be in distfiles (or a local distfiles cache), and the md5sum will not match, aborting the emerge.

Looks like the file was changed (upstream) without changing the filename.  Out of Gentoo's control, but annoying.

Workaround: Remove the file from /usr/local/distfiles (and any local distfiles caches), then re-emerge, and it'll work.

I don't think there's a real fix for this (except to ask the author to not change files without bumping the version in the filename :-> ) ; I'm just entering the bug to document the workaround.
